Student Disappearance in the Greater Houston Area

The Houston Chronicle has a guest blog by me today that looks at the number of 3rd grade students who took the TAKS test in the spring of 2003 who are still enrolled in school in 2011.

See http://blog.chron.com/schoolzone/2011/10/where-are-all-the-third-graders-now/

Below are some more details on the numbers I discuss in the blog. Looking at the number of students who remain in the Texas public education system is important in that many of those students who disappear simply drop out of school. And, as we will see, we can actually predict who is at-risk of disappearing/dropping out as early as the third grade.
